Suffering is not a badge of pride, but a testimony to love that refuses to quit.

Paul boasts not in strength, but in weakness—because it is there that grace is most visible.

The Christian life is not marked by ease, but by perseverance through danger, rejection, and fatigue.

What matters most is not the scars themselves, but the heart that bears them for the sake of others.

Paul’s anxiety is not self-centred. It flows from deep responsibility for the well-being of the Church.

Leadership rooted in compassion will always feel the wounds of others.

To follow Christ is to choose faithfulness over fame, sacrifice over status.

And if we must boast, let it be in what reveals our dependence on God.

2 Corinthians 11:18,​21-30. Matthew 6:19-23.
